Aaron Moody achieves selection for the England Boys Squad!

Aaron enjoyed a wonderful season in both his Surrey and England shirt, helping both sides win the SEG League and Home Internationals respectively. He particularly enjoyed his travels to Scotland winning both the Scottish Boys Championship and the SSGT Championship while also achieving success closer to home at Farnham and Walton Heath where he finished 2nd in the England U18 Championship and London Amateur Foursomes.

Everyone at Surrey Golf is really proud of everything Aaron has achieved this year and we are excited to see what 2026 holds for the England superstar!

ENGLAND BOYS’ SQUAD

Alex Boyes (Teesside, Yorkshire, 16)
- 2nd-place at North of England U16 Championship
- Tied-3rd place finish at 2025 Fairhaven Trophy
- Top-15 finish at 2025 English U18 Championship
- Helped England win the 2025 Girls’ & Boys’ Home Internationals
- Nine appearances for England as U16 player

Thomas Hartshorne (Teesside, Yorkshire, 16)
- Helped England win the 2025 Girls’ & Boys’ Home Internationals
- Represented England at 2025 European Boys’ Team Championship and European Young Masters
- Finished 2nd in the 2025 Fairhaven Trophy after missing out in a play-off
-Tied-3rd finish at 2025 Peter McEvoy Trophy
- Top-15 finish at 2025 McGregor Trophy

Aaron Moody (Burhill, Surrey, 16)
- Won the 2025 Scottish Boys’ Open Championship
- Won the 2025 U18 SSGT Stroke Play Championship
- Helped England win the 2025 Girls’ & Boys’ Home Internationals
- Finished 2nd at 2025 English U18 Championship
- 4th-place finish at North of England U16 Championship
- Top-15 finish at 2025 Italian Boys’ Championship

Cameron Mukherjee (Gullane, 17)
- Semi-finalist at the 2025 English Amateur Championship
- Runner-up after play-off in the 2025 South African Amateur
- Reached semi-finals of 2024 St Andrews Boys’ Open
- Tied-4th at 2024 Scottish Boys’ Open Championship

Ben Sessions (Bishop’s Stortford, Hertfordshire, 17)
- 3rd-place finish at 2025 Carris Trophy, shooting a course record -7 on the second day of the event
- 3rd-place finish at Spanish International U18 Championship
- Helped England win the 2025 Girls’ & Boys’ Home Internationals
- Tied-6th finishes at 2025 Peter McEvoy Trophy and Berkhamsted Trophy
- Tied-11th at 2025 Lagonda Trophy and top-15 finish at Fairhaven Trophy

George Whitehead, (Hillside, Lancashire, 15)
- 3rd-place finish at 2025 Scottish Boys’ U16 Open Championship
- 3rd-place finish at 2025 Sir Henry Cooper Junior Masters
- Represented England at 2025 European Young Masters, finishing tied-11th in individual standings
- Top-10 finishes at 2025 Italian International Boys’, and North of England U16s
- Top-15 finishes at 2025 McGregor Trophy and Scottish Boys’ Championship
